Abstract
The energy hole phenomenon has been a great hinderance in efficient performance of Wireless Sensor Networks (WSNs). In this paper, energy hole problem is addressed with reference to variable transmission range of sensor nodes and static number of Cluster Heads (CHs), which aggregate the data of their region and forward it to next CH or Base Station (BS). Network field is first divided into regions and then a fixed number of nodes are deployed to overcome the coverage hole problem. This strategy balances the energy consumption, overcomes the energy and coverage hole problem and thereby extending the stability of network.
